Now you see him, now you don’t; Steve Wignall’s time as Boro’ manager won’t be setting any records given the short amount of time spent together. By replacing Richard Hill with Mr Wignall, it looked as if we’d got ourselves an experienced pro who had previously led Colchester United to promotion.
Boro’ was his next gig after leaving Layer Road; his belief was that he’d taken the Essex side as far as he could. We doubt he’d be saying the same thing about his time with us, however. Eight games into his tenure, Wignall was heading for Doncaster Rovers; moving on freely after (apparently) not signing a binding contract with us.
It’s not for us to say how true that may be, but it his swift departure means we have little else to add on Mr Wignall.
